.pagination-container[data-v-90fd946a]{background:#fff}.pagination-container.hidden[data-v-90fd946a]{display:none}.filter-row[data-v-f9cf3378]{margin-bottom:20px}.filter-item[data-v-f9cf3378]{margin-right:10px}.tab-content[data-v-f9cf3378]{padding:20px 0}.content-cell-simple[data-v-f9cf3378]{width:100%;background:none;border:none;padding:0}.content-text-simple[data-v-f9cf3378]{white-space:pre-line;word-break:break-all;line-height:1.6;color:#333;background:none;border:none;padding:0;margin:0;font-size:14px;text-align:left}.options-cell[data-v-f9cf3378]{max-width:200px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.questions-cell[data-v-f9cf3378]{max-width:none;overflow-y:auto;max-height:none;white-space:normal;word-break:break-word;line-height:1.5;min-height:60px;padding:8px 0}.el-table .el-table__row[data-v-f9cf3378]{height:auto!important}.el-table .el-table__cell[data-v-f9cf3378]{padding:12px 0;vertical-align:top}.tag-filter-container[data-v-f9cf3378]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:20px;-ms-flex-wrap:wrap;flex-wrap:wrap}.tag-filter-container .el-button[data-v-f9cf3378],.tag-filter-container .el-input[data-v-f9cf3378],.tag-filter-container .el-select[data-v-f9cf3378]{margin-bottom:10px}.wide-transfer[data-v-f9cf3378] .el-transfer-panel{width:400px!important;min-width:400px!important}.ai-icon[data-v-f9cf3378]{display:inline-block;width:20px;height:20px;border-radius:50%;background:linear-gradient(135deg,#667eea,#764ba2);color:#fff;font-size:12px;font-weight:700;text-align:center;line-height:20px;margin-left:8px;vertical-align:middle;-webkit-box-shadow:0 2px 4px rgba(0,0,0,.2);box-shadow:0 2px 4px rgba(0,0,0,.2);cursor:help}.generated-question[data-v-f9cf3378]{border:1px solid #ebeef5;border-radius:8px;padding:20px;margin-bottom:20px;background-color:#f9fafc;-webkit-box-shadow:0 2px 8px rgba(0,0,0,.1);box-shadow:0 2px 8px rgba(0,0,0,.1);-webkit-transition:all .3s ease;transition:all .3s ease}.generated-question[data-v-f9cf3378]:hover{-webkit-box-shadow:0 4px 12px rgba(0,0,0,.15);box-shadow:0 4px 12px rgba(0,0,0,.15);-webkit-transform:translateY(-2px);transform:translateY(-2px)}.question-header[data-v-f9cf3378]{-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:15px;padding-bottom:15px;border-bottom:2px solid #ebeef5}.question-header[data-v-f9cf3378],.question-number[data-v-f9cf3378]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.question-number[data-v-f9cf3378]{font-size:18px;font-weight:700;color:#409eff}.question-number[data-v-f9cf3378]:before{content:"📝";margin-right:8px;font-size:20px}.question-content[data-v-f9cf3378]{font-size:14px;color:#606266}.content-item[data-v-f9cf3378]{margin-bottom:15px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.content-item label[data-v-f9cf3378]{font-weight:700;margin-right:15px;min-width:90px;color:#303133;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.content-item label[data-v-f9cf3378]:before{margin-right:5px}.content-item:first-child label[data-v-f9cf3378]:before{content:"📖"}.content-item:nth-child(2) label[data-v-f9cf3378]:before{content:"✅"}.content-item:nth-child(3) label[data-v-f9cf3378]:before{content:"🔢"}.content-text[data-v-f9cf3378]{font-style:italic;color:#303133;line-height:1.6;background-color:#f5f7fa;border-left:4px solid #409eff}.answer-text[data-v-f9cf3378],.content-text[data-v-f9cf3378]{-webkit-box-flex:1;-ms-flex:1;flex:1;padding:12px;border-radius:6px;-webkit-box-shadow:inset 0 1px 3px rgba(0,0,0,.1);box-shadow:inset 0 1px 3px rgba(0,0,0,.1)}.answer-text[data-v-f9cf3378]{font-weight:700;color:#67c23a;background-color:#f0f9ff;border-left:4px solid #67c23a}.no-questions[data-v-f9cf3378]{padding:60px;text-align:center;color:#909399}.content-cell[data-v-f9cf3378]{position:relative;width:100%}.content-text[data-v-f9cf3378]{white-space:pre-line;word-break:break-all;line-height:1.5;max-height:4.2em;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;-webkit-transition:max-height .3s ease;transition:max-height .3s ease}.content-text.expanded[data-v-f9cf3378]{max-height:none;-webkit-line-clamp:unset;overflow:visible}@media (max-width:768px){.content-text[data-v-f9cf3378]{max-height:3.6em;-webkit-line-clamp:2}.content-text.expanded[data-v-f9cf3378]{max-height:none;-webkit-line-clamp:unset}}@media (max-width:480px){.content-text[data-v-f9cf3378]{max-height:3em;-webkit-line-clamp:2}}.questions-content[data-v-f9cf3378]{max-height:200px;overflow-y:auto;-webkit-transition:max-height .3s ease;transition:max-height .3s ease}.questions-content.expanded[data-v-f9cf3378]{max-height:none;overflow:visible}.ai-dialog-content-text[data-v-f9cf3378],.reading-content-text[data-v-f9cf3378]{-webkit-box-flex:1;-ms-flex:1;flex:1;white-space:pre-line;word-break:break-all;line-height:1.6;color:#303133;padding:12px;background-color:#f5f7fa;border-radius:6px;border-left:4px solid #409eff;-webkit-box-shadow:inset 0 1px 3px rgba(0,0,0,.1);box-shadow:inset 0 1px 3px rgba(0,0,0,.1);max-height:none;overflow:visible}.sub-question-item[data-v-f9cf3378]{margin-bottom:15px;padding:12px;border-left:3px solid #409eff;background-color:#f8f9fa;border-radius:4px;-webkit-box-shadow:0 1px 3px rgba(0,0,0,.1);box-shadow:0 1px 3px rgba(0,0,0,.1)}.sub-question-text[data-v-f9cf3378]{font-weight:700;margin-bottom:8px;color:#303133;line-height:1.5}.sub-question-answer[data-v-f9cf3378]{margin-top:8px;color:#67c23a;font-weight:700;padding:6px 8px;background-color:#f0f9ff;border-radius:4px;border-left:3px solid #67c23a}.responsive-table[data-v-f9cf3378]{width:100%}@media (max-width:1200px){.responsive-table .el-table__body-wrapper[data-v-f9cf3378],.responsive-table .el-table__header-wrapper[data-v-f9cf3378]{overflow-x:auto}}@media (max-width:768px){.responsive-table .el-table__cell[data-v-f9cf3378],.responsive-table .el-table__header-cell[data-v-f9cf3378]{padding:8px 4px;font-size:12px}}.questions-cell-simple[data-v-f9cf3378]{width:100%}.questions-cell-simple[data-v-f9cf3378],.questions-content-simple[data-v-f9cf3378]{background:none;border:none;padding:0;margin:0}.question-item[data-v-f9cf3378]{margin-bottom:15px;padding:0;background:none;border:none}.question-title[data-v-f9cf3378]{font-weight:700;margin-bottom:8px;color:#333;background:none;padding:0}.option-item[data-v-f9cf3378]{margin-bottom:5px;padding:0;background:none;border:none;color:#666;line-height:1.4}.option-item.correct-answer[data-v-f9cf3378]{color:#67c23a;font-weight:700}.correct-mark[data-v-f9cf3378]{margin-left:5px;color:#67c23a;font-weight:700}.options-list[data-v-f9cf3378]{background:none;border:none;padding:0;margin:0}.correct-answer-display[data-v-f9cf3378]{margin-top:8px;color:#67c23a;font-weight:700;background:none;padding:0}